Roger Bergman is a scholar working on Information Systems and Management, Education and Political Science and International Relations. According to data from OpenAlex, Roger Bergman has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 276 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Information Systems and Management, 4 papers in Education and 2 papers in Political Science and International Relations. Recurrent topics in Roger Bergman's work include Ethics in Business and Education (4 papers), Pragmatism in Philosophy and Education (2 papers) and Psychology of Moral and Emotional Judgment (2 papers). Roger Bergman is often cited by papers focused on Ethics in Business and Education (4 papers), Pragmatism in Philosophy and Education (2 papers) and Psychology of Moral and Emotional Judgment (2 papers). Roger Bergman collaborates with scholars based in United States.
